London Boots at Target

Last month, my husband, who works for Target's distribution center, spilled the beans that cosmetics and bath company, Boots, will be the newest international brand.

From micro-dermabrasion kits to lip gloss, Boots will bringing it's products from across the pond to my favorite discount store. The best part is that very select Target stores will also have a Boots consultant, in store. I don't know exactly what kind of consulting they will do, maybe which skin products to use or demonstrate how to use them?

I love that Target keeps bringing in department store experiences-high end fashion designers, home accessory designers, stationary designers and now, beauty counters-at prices we can afford.
